Что такое алгоритмы и как они применяются в нынешних разработках
Алгоритмы являют собой цепочку ясно определённых инструкций для разрешения конкретной проблемы. Каждый алгоритм имеет исходные данные и планируемый исход. Передовые решения применяют алгоритмы на каждом этапе функционирования цифровых комплексов.
Компьютерные программы складываются из множества алгоритмов, которые анализируют сведения и производят всевозможные операции. Смартфоны задействуют алгоритмы для опознавания лиц и улучшения работы аккумулятора. Интернет-сервисы применяют казино без депозита для индивидуализации содержимого.
Поисковые системы применяют комплексные алгоритмы для сортировки веб-страниц и выдачи подходящих данных. Социальные сети применяют алгоритмы для составления информационной потока каждого пользователя.
Финансовые учреждения применяют алгоритмы для исследования угроз и распознавания мошеннических платежей. Транспортные системы задействуют казино для оптимизации путей и контроля трафиком.
Эволюция решений привело к созданию алгоритмов компьютерного обучения и искусственного разума. Эти алгоритмы анализируют модели и составляют прогнозы на основе больших наборов сведений.
Дефиниция алгоритма и его фундаментальные особенности
Алгоритм служит чётким представлением последовательности манипуляций, ориентированных на достижение заданного исхода. Математики и программисты создали официальное определение алгоритма как ограниченного набора правил, пригодных к исходным информации.
Любой алгоритм имеет множеством ключевых свойств, которые отличают его от элементарной директивы:
- Дискретность обозначает членение хода на самостоятельные базовые этапы
- Определённость предполагает ясного трактовки каждого этапа
- Результативность обеспечивает достижение результата за ограниченное количество этапов
- Массовость даёт задействовать алгоритм к полному классу задач
Определённые алгоритмы неизменно генерируют равный результат при одних и тех же начальных информации. Стохастические алгоритмы применяют казино онлайн для достижения исхода с конкретной степенью достоверности.
Результативность алгоритма измеряется по периоду реализации и величине применяемой памяти. Идеальные алгоритмы разрешают задание с наименьшими расходами компьютерных средств.
Функция алгоритмов в ежедневной электронной действительности
Современный человек постоянно соприкасается с десятками алгоритмов, часто не осознавая их присутствия. Утренний будильник на смартфоне задействует алгоритмы для отслеживания стадий сна и выбора оптимального времени пробуждения. Навигационные приложения используют алгоритмы для определения пути с рассмотрением транспортной ситуации.
Мобильные банковские утилиты используют казино без депозита для выполнения переводов и контроля защищённости платежей. Камеры смартфонов используют алгоритмы для повышения уровня снимков. Голосовые ассистенты определяют речь благодаря комплексным алгоритмам обработки аудио.
Онлайн-магазины используют алгоритмы для подбора товаров на основе хроники посещений. Музыкальные службы создают личные подборки, исследуя вкусы аудитории. Видеоплатформы предлагают контент с посредством алгоритмов, исследующих активность участников.
Интеллектуальные жилища применяют алгоритмы для роботизации подсветки и обогрева. Фитнес-трекеры считают шаги и калории с посредством обработки сведений с сенсоров. Алгоритмы сделались обязательной компонентом будничной жизни.
Алгоритмы в поисковых системах и рекомендательных сервисах
Поисковые системы выполняют миллиарды вопросов каждодневно, задействуя сложные алгоритмы сортировки данных. Эти алгоритмы рассматривают контент веб-страниц, их соответствие вопросу и надёжность сайта. Поисковые системы задействуют казино онлайн для установления наиболее релевантных результатов.
Алгоритмы упорядочивания принимают массу факторов при составлении результатов:
- Соответствие содержимого поисковому вопросу участника
- Качество и неповторимость текстового материала веб-страницы
- Количество и уровень гиперссылок, направляющих на страницу
- Темп открытия и комфорт эксплуатации портала
Рекомендательные системы задействуют алгоритмы коллаборативной селекции для предсказания предпочтений. Контентные алгоритмы рассматривают свойства продуктов для выбора схожих вариантов. Смешанные системы комбинируют несколько подходов для повышения точности советов.
Алгоритмы компьютерного обучения регулярно оптимизируют качество нахождения. Системы изучают активность участников и продолжительность просмотра для улучшения данных.
Применение алгоритмов в социальных сетях
Социальные сети применяют алгоритмы для создания индивидуализированной потока новостей каждого пользователя. Платформы исследуют взаимодействия с контентом, чтобы показывать максимально привлекательные публикации. Алгоритмы учитывают лайки, отзывы и время ознакомления для определения соответствия материала.
Алгоритмы социальных сетей используют казино без депозита для сортировки материалов знакомых и групп. Системы учитывают новизну контента и популярность автора. Видеоматериал зачастую обретает первенство в выдаче благодаря алгоритмам раскрутки.
Рекламные алгоритмы подбирают нужную публику на фундаменте предпочтений и действий участников. Платформы задействуют алгоритмы для борьбы с нежелательным содержимым и мусором. Системы модерации самостоятельно обнаруживают нарушения требований объединения.
Алгоритмы советуют новых знакомых и занимательные сообщества на базе имеющихся соединений. Социальные сети используют казино для исследования схемы социальных связей и определения общих интересов. Платформы регулярно обновляют алгоритмы для оптимизации пользовательского восприятия.
Алгоритмы в банковских разработках и онлайн-платежах
Финансовые организации задействуют алгоритмы для осуществления миллионов транзакций постоянно. Банковские системы используют алгоритмы шифрования для обеспечения закрытых сведений заказчиков. Платёжные сервисы контролируют законность операций с содействием казино онлайн анализа поведенческих моделей.
Алгоритмы обнаружения мошенничества анализируют каждую платёж в режиме актуального момента. Системы оценивают расположение, величину транзакции и историю приобретений. Странные платежи замораживаются автоматически для избежания финансовых потерь.
Кредитный скоринг использует алгоритмы для анализа кредитоспособности должников. Системы рассматривают кредитную историю и финансовые данные. Алгоритмы содействуют финансовым учреждениям формировать постановления о предоставлении кредитов оперативнее.
Трейдинговые алгоритмы на рынках осуществляют сделки за фрагменты мгновения. Скоростная купля-продажа использует алгоритмы для исследования рыночных сведений. Криптовалютные системы применяют бездепозитные бонусы казино для выполнения децентрализованных платежей. Алгоритмы улучшают взносы и темп выполнения транзакций.
Задействование алгоритмов в игровых сервисах
Видеостриминговые платформы применяют алгоритмы для настройки советов содержимого. Платформы изучают хронику просмотров и рейтинги картин для отбора подходящих контента. Алгоритмы принимают жанровые предпочтения и востребованность содержимого среди схожих юзеров.
Музыкальные приложения применяют алгоритмы для формирования самостоятельных плейлистов на основе состояния пользователя. Системы рассматривают ритм произведений и направления для составления сбалансированных подборок. Алгоритмы радио задействуют казино без депозита для селекции схожих треков и открытия новых артистов.
Игровые платформы используют алгоритмы для выбора оппонентов с похожим уровнем квалификации. Системы матчмейкинга гарантируют сбалансированные группы и захватывающие игровые матчи. Алгоритмы генерации контента производят уникальные этапы в проектах.
Подкаст-приложения задействуют алгоритмы для совета выпусков по интересам участника. Сервисы виртуальных произведений применяют для рекомендации литературы похожих жанров. Алгоритмы гибкого трансляции регулируют качество контента под скорость связи.
Алгоритмы защищённости и охраны данных
Криптографические алгоритмы обеспечивают конфиденциальность отправки данных в интернете. Системы кодирования конвертируют информацию в зашифрованный облик для охраны от несанкционированного входа. Алгоритмы асимметричного криптования используют набор шифров для надёжного передачи посланиями.
Алгоритмы хеширования производят уникальные электронные хеши документов и паролей. Системы держат хеши паролей вместо оригинальных данных для увеличения надёжности. Алгоритмы проверяют неизменность данных и определяют модификации в файлах.
Антивирусные приложения задействуют алгоритмы сигнатурного исследования для выявления известных рисков. Системы действенного исследования задействуют для определения свежих видов вредоносного программного софта.
Системы двухфакторной верификации применяют алгоритмы создания одноразовых кодов для защиты учётных записей. Биометрические алгоритмы определяют узоры пальцев и физиономии. Межсетевые экраны задействуют для селекции сетевого трафика и запрета странных связей.
Компьютерное обучение и синтетический интеллект на базе алгоритмов
Алгоритмы машинного обучения позволяют электронным структурам тренироваться на информации без явного кодирования. Нейронные сети используют многослойные алгоритмы для определения шаблонов и принятия вердиктов. Системы глубокого обучения используют казино для изучения фото, надписи и звука.
Алгоритмы обучения с супервизором функционируют с помеченными данными для категоризации и предсказания. Системы обучаются на примерах с распознанными верными ответами. Алгоритмы тренировки без наставника определяют скрытые зависимости в информации.
Алгоритмы переработки живого языка позволяют системам осознавать человеческую голос. Системы автоматического перевода применяют нейронные сети для преобразования содержимого между наречиями. Чат-боты применяют алгоритмы для поддержания диалогов с юзерами.
Цифровое восприятие задействует алгоритмы для идентификации элементов на фото. Самоуправляемые транспортные машины применяют казино онлайн для ориентации на трассе. Медицинские системы используют алгоритмы для диагностики заболеваний по снимкам.
Воздействие алгоритмов на пользовательский восприятие
Алгоритмы создают цифровой восприятие миллиардов пользователей каждодневно. Персонализация материала превращает взаимодействие с сервисами более простым и уместным. Системы настраиваются под персональные вкусы, сохраняя период на поиск данных.
Алгоритмы совершенствования панелей совершенствуют перемещение и упрощают выполнение задач. Системы A/B проверки задействуют казино для выбора наиболее продуктивных вариантов дизайна. Динамичные алгоритмы подстраивают вывод материала под величину монитора устройства.
Предиктивные алгоритмы предугадывают шаги участников и советуют уместные подсказки. Автозаполнение полей и предложения вопросов ускоряют общение с платформами. Алгоритмы сохранения обеспечивают скоростную загрузку часто используемых информации.
Однако чрезмерная индивидуализация создаёт информационные коконы, ограничивая многообразие содержимого. Юзеры видят лишь публикации, подходящие их имеющимся мнениям. Алгоритмы способны усиливать предубеждённость и клише. Прозрачность действия алгоритмов становится существенным условием для формирования уверенности к виртуальным системам.